St. Louis Office / Corporate Headquarters

CK Power traces its presence in St. Louis, Missouri, back to 1929 when the Western Machinery Company began distributing power transmission equipment there. Today, it acts as the corporate headquarters for all CK Power operations.

Services and Products Offered:

CK Power

1100 Research Boulevard,
St. Louis, MO 63132
Click Here for Directions
Hours: 8am-5pm, Monday-Friday
Phone: (314) 868-8620
Fax: (314) 868-9314

Emergency After Hours:
(314) 868-8620
– option #7